Understanding a True HVAC Emergency

Not every HVAC problem is an emergency. So, what is? Safety is the biggest factor. You should call for emergency HVAC service right away if you have no heat during freezing overnight temperatures, if your AC fails completely during a dangerous heatwave, or if you smell natural gas near your furnace. Other urgent situations include hearing loud banging from your system, seeing smoke or sparks, or discovering a major water leak from your indoor AC unit. For anything involving potential gas leaks or carbon monoxide, evacuate first and then call.

Common HVAC Problems We See in Lagunitas Forest Knolls

We’ve seen it all serving this community. One common issue is a clogged condensate drain line, which causes an AC to leak water inside the house—a problem we often fix for folks in the Forest Knolls neighborhoods. Another is a failing capacitor in the outdoor AC unit during a summer spike, which stops cooling entirely. In winter, a dirty flame sensor in a furnace can prevent it from igniting, leaving you without heat on a chilly night. We once helped a family in the Lagunitas area who had a carbon monoxide alarm sound due to a cracked heat exchanger in their old furnace—a serious but fixable situation that underscores the need for professional service.

A Transparent Look at HVAC Service Costs

We believe in clear, upfront pricing. Most HVAC service calls start with a standard diagnostic fee, which covers the technician’s time to pinpoint the problem. For an emergency or after-hours call, there is typically an additional emergency call-out fee, and labor rates may be higher. The final cost then depends on the parts needed and the labor to fix it. For example, a routine service call for a clogged drain line might be a few hundred dollars, while an emergency replacement of a failed compressor on a weekend would be more. We always provide a detailed estimate before any work begins.

Signs You Need Immediate HVAC Service

  • No heat when outside temperatures are near or below freezing.
  • Your carbon monoxide alarm is sounding.
  • You smell a strong odor of natural gas or rotten eggs (mercaptan).
  • You see smoke or smell burning from your HVAC equipment.
  • Water is pooling around your indoor air handler or furnace.
  • There are loud banging, screeching, or arcing electrical noises.
  • Your AC provides no cooling during a period of extreme heat.

Safety Checklist While You Wait for Help

  • If you smell gas, leave your home immediately and call your gas company from outside.
  • If your CO alarm sounds, evacuate everyone, including pets, and call 911 if anyone feels ill.
  • If it is safe to do so, turn off your HVAC system at the thermostat.
  • Do not touch any electrical components if you suspect a problem.
  • Move children, elderly family members, or anyone with health issues to a comfortable, safe location if possible.
  • Remember: Never attempt to repair gas lines or high-voltage electrical components yourself.
